Abstract
The purpose of this study was to find out and compare the descriptive data and the anaerobic power of elite track cyclists by sex. Wingate Anaerobic Test (WAnT) was chosen to explore anaerobic power and the load of this study was chosen 13.3% of body weight. The participants in this study were 4 male American elite track cyclists and 4 female American elite track cyclists . The mean peak power (PP), relative peak power (RPP), mean power (MP), and relative mean power (RMP) values of the male American elite track cyclists were 1463.25±96.98 W, 18.78±1.58 W· kg-1, 984.75±67.46 W and 12.70±1.66 W·kg-1, respectively. The mean peak power (PP), relative peak power (RPP), mean power (MP), and relative mean power (RMP) values of the female American elite track cyclists were 1331.5±199.84 W, 22.12±4.56 W· kg-1, 951±158.44 W, and 15.87±4.10 W·kg-1, respectively. Based on the above research methods and procedures, this study produced the following results. First, there were height and weight differences between man and woman elite cyclists, but no age differences. Second, man elite cyclists had a higher peak power and mean power than woman elite cyclists, but woman elite cyclists had a higher relative power both peak and mean power.
